Top Speed: 304.773 mph (490.484 km/h)
Horsepower: 1,577 hp
Engine: 8.0-liter quad-turbo W16
Price: ~$3.9 million
Bugatti rewrote the rulebook in 2019 by becoming the first production car to break the 300 mph barrier. With an extended body, aerodynamic tweaks, and sheer mechanical muscle, the Chiron Super Sport 300+ is a technological masterpiece.

Top Speed (Verified): 282.9 mph (average)
Horsepower: 1,750 hp
Engine: 5.9-liter twin-turbo V8
Price: ~$2 million
Despite controversy around its initial 331 mph claim, SSC later proved the Tuatara is still among the world’s fastest. Its blend of lightweight design and high-tech performance reflects America’s bold entry into hypercar territory.

Top Speed: 258 mph
Horsepower: 1,914 hp
Motors: Four electric motors (one per wheel)
Price: ~$2.2 million
Proof that EVs can be insanely fast, the Nevera is Croatia’s contribution to the hypercar war. With torque-vectoring, adaptive AI, and instant power delivery, it is the current fastest all-electric production car.

Electric vehicles have an edge in acceleration due to instant torque. However, combustion engines still dominate top-speed records due to thermal limitations in batteries. Hybrid models are beginning to bridge that gap, combining the best of both worlds.
Example:
Rimac Nevera (Electric): 258 mph
Bugatti Chiron Super Sport 300+ (Combustion): 304+ mph
As battery tech and cooling systems improve, the balance may shift.
